The majority of children have isolated asymptomatic microscopic … WebHypertension is defined as persistent elevation of systolic BP of 140mmHg or greater and/or diastolic BP of 90 mmHg or greater. The prevalence of hypertension in Malaysians aged 18 years and above was 32% and for aged 30 years and above was 43% in 2011. Hypertension is a silent disease; the majority of cases (61%) in the country remain undiagnosed.
